[Python-de] NULL-Zeichen in Kommandozeilenargumenten, wie (wenn überhaupt)?

Dinu Gherman gherman at darwin.in-berlin.de
Do Jan 3 12:59:44 CET 2013


Am 03.01.2013 um 10:35 schrieb Hartmut Goebel:

> 3) tool.py liest die Argumente von stdin, wie es xargs auch macht:
> find sample -print0 | ./tool.py --stdin
> 4) Nichts machen, Benutzer sollen xargs verwenden. Das wäre mein Ansatz, dann das wäre, was Unix-erfahrene User erwarten würden. (Funktioniert natürlich nur, wenn Du Unix-erfahrene User hast :-)

Tja... ;-) Wahrscheinlich läuft es darauf hinaus, dass man entweder die 
Dateisuche von der Kommandozeile ins eigentliche Tool verlagert (python-
ischer, aber weniger flexibel) und/oder eine temporäre Datei mit den wie 
auch immer gefundenen Dateipfaden benutzt. - Trotzdem danke!

Gruß,

Dinu



Mehr Informationen über die Mailingliste python-de